CRA’s Distribution System Planning and Modernization experts support utilities in modernizing and optimizing their distribution systems to meet growing customer demands, integrate new technologies, and enhance reliability and resilience. Our team combines technical, economic, and regulatory expertise to help utilities develop data-driven, forward-looking distribution plans that align with operational realities, emerging risks, and stakeholder expectations.

We assist utilities in evaluating hosting capacity, reliability performance, DER integration, electrification impacts, wildfire exposure, and investment prioritization across their distribution networks. CRA’s work ensures that system upgrades, mitigation strategies, and modernization efforts are analytically justified, cost-effective, and defensible in regulatory proceedings.

Through these services, CRA helps utilities strengthen reliability, reduce wildfire and climate-driven risks, enhance customer and community resilience, and position distribution systems for the future grid.
